The "International Journal of Business Intelligence and Data Mining," also published quarterly, covers the areas of business intelligence, intelligent data analysis and data mining with a focus on the application of data analysis and mining techniques in business. An annual subscription to either title costs $450 for the print or the online editions; $545 for both editions.
